Output 6d19131353b61d65eeb691f7c12fca2cb52fc58aeee7a01a8bcbaa3de0984071:14

value
22188525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 900d69e3caafc18cf5c4dd397dc552e1f3b42ae1 OP_EQUAL
address
3EphJAQ1ieV1AD2obfHJVqr5kdvDLLikZm
transaction
6d19131353b61d65eeb691f7c12fca2cb52fc58aeee7a01a8bcbaa3de0984071
spent
true